Job Overview

Come join the Risk Operations in our Fintech Business Unit as a Learning and Development Facilitator.

Responsibilities

  • Training conducted based on well-defined curriculum
  • Classrooms set up properly (materials, technology, space)
  • Daily program/course schedules for multiple day classes aligned with design plan or adjusted to meet audience needs
  • Training compliance audits for outsourcers and vendors
  • Audit reports and recommendations for compliance gaps and performance gaps
  • Coaches/Supervisors/Managers trained to support trainees' transfer of learning from the classroom or technical based training (TBT) to the job
  • Needs analyses input
  • Delivery of train the trainer programs
  • Program/course effectiveness feedback delivered to designers
  • Workshops/courses delivery based on specific content and style required by the partner and/or customer
  • Evaluation input regarding the effectiveness of trainers they are mentoring

Qualifications

  • 2+ years of relevant experience in risk management
  • Proficient with G-Suite and other relevant software
  • Strong analytical and critical thinking skills with attention to detail
  • Proven ability to deescalate customers and effectively handle difficult situations
  • Strong organizational skills and the ability to manage multiple tasks
  • Ability to work under tight deadlines and prioritize tasks to meet SLAs
  • Strong work ethic with high integrity and ethics
  • Effective collaboration and teamwork skills
  • Strong understanding of customer service and customer empathy
  • Willingness to learn and adapt to new technologies and processes.
  • A bachelor's degree in finance, risk management, accounting or related field a plus
  • Delivers training programs, workshops and classes
  • Manages the classroom through effective facilitation processes that enable efficient delivery of curriculum and a training environment conducive to learnin
  • Partners with Training managers to identify and close organizational performance gaps specific to supported areas
  • Provides coaching, mentoring, and informal leadership to other trainers
  • Teaches other trainers and non-trainers to deliver well-defined training programs. Mentors / coaches other individuals delivering workshops
  • Partners with instructional designers during needs analyses to analyze new or redesigned workshops and provides input and feedback after course is delivered
  • Works flexible hours to support delivery of workshops which exceed the typical workday
  • Travels at least 25-50% of the time
